  • AI Programmer

    Description

    The AI Programmer will work closely with the Lead Software Engineer and the rest of the development team to design and program AI systems for a next-generation first-person shooter game. This entails multiple levels of AI, and touches on several topics including navigation, behaviors, group coordination, environment awareness, tactics, goal-based planning, and terrain analysis.

  • Associate Producer

    Description

    Associate Producers coordinate with other departments to track the production pipeline, manage assets, identify risks, bring forward schedule red flags, and troubleshoot communication and schedule dependency problems. Each Associate Producer works directly with a different subset of the game, such as a specific console platform or the other online features.
    Responsibilities may also include quality assurance management, milestone preparation, localization, archiving, scheduling, organizing, budgeting, coordinating & managing issues and external contract development efforts and other aspects of game production.

  • Game Writer

     
    Description
     
    As a Game Writer, you will be responsible for creating stories, plots, and written content for TimeGate’s diverse projects. Your passion lies in generating characters, backgrounds, and worlds for use in a variety of projects across different mediums. One day you’re writing dialogue and screenplays for in-game cinematics and the next you’re providing background text for a website narrative.
     
    Game writers work closely with the design and audio teams, collaborating on works to best fit the project’s gameplay and content. The game writer is also heavily involved in dialogue and voice recording sessions, reviewing audition materials, directing sessions, and helping pick takes.
     
    As a true game writer, you know the difference between writing for games and writing for other mediums, seamlessly shifting between styles as needed. A master of the creative pen, the game writer relishes every storyboard, script, and flavor text string as a chance to build a better fiction.
